# FDA recall Z-1704-2025

> **Medtronic Neuromodulation** · Class II · device recall initiated 2025-04-03.

## Product

Enhanced Verify Evaluation Handset (CFN HH90130FA)

## Reason for recall

Evaluation handsets may not be able to communicate with the neurostimulator due to handsets having a faster processing speed than prior handsets. An inability to connect may cause the therapy to stop being delivered and a system error will be displayed. Patient may experience return of underlying disease symptoms (e.g. overactive bladder, urinary retention, or fecal incontinence) based on their response to stimulation during the evaluation period.
